GOD GIVES AUTHORITY
One Saturday, the seventh day of the week also called the Sabbath,
Jesus was walking through a grain field with His apprentices. His
apprentices were taking some of the heads of grain, rubbing them
in their hands and then eating the grain. Some of the legalistic
religious leaders accused them of working, by harvesting grain on
the Sabbath, which was against the Jewish law. Jesus responded, by
reminding them how David once broke religious laws, when he and
his men were hungry and then stated "THE SABBATH WAS
MADE TO BENEFIT MAN, AND NOT MAN TO BENEFIT
THE SABBATH. AND I, THE MESSIAH, HAVE
AUTHORITY EVEN TO DECIDE WHAT MEN CAN DO ON
SABBATH DAYS" [Mk 2:28 TL]{Mt 12:8}{Lk 6:5}. Manmade
religious laws frequently conflicted with Jesus in His ministry.
Remember Jesus said what God told Him to "SAY" [Jn 12:49].
People are still making up religious rules today. Our best defense is
to follow Jesus' example and seek God's guidance. Does God guide
you?
